ABSTRACT

BACKGROUND: Obstructive sleep apnea (OSA) is strongly associated with atrial fibrillation (AF). Long-term ECG monitoring with implantable loop recorders facilitates the identification of undiagnosed AF in 20% of severe OSA cases. However, ambulatory ECG (AECG) monitoring is less resource intensive, and various parameters have been shown to predict AF. The aim of this study was to assess the efficacy of such AECG-based AF predictors in identifying patients with severe OSA most at risk. METHODS: Prospective observational study including patients with severe OSA and no history of AF. Patients had two 24-h AECG recordings, and if no AF was detected, implanted with a loop recorder (maximum 3 years). RESULTS: Of 25 patients implanted, AF ≥ 10 s was detected in 5 patients. None of the parameters from the AECG recordings were significantly different between patients who did and did not develop AF. CONCLUSIONS: AECG-based parameters were not effective for the prediction of AF in this severe OSA cohort.

ABSTRACT

BACKGROUND: Between 2010 and 2012, the Heart Rhythm team in a tertiary care hospital completed a retrospective study that found that atrial fibrillation (AF) care can be episodic and heavily reliant on hospital resources, particularly the emergency department (ED). PROBLEM: Patients who attend the ED with AF are at high risk of hospital admission. APPROACH: A nurse practitioner (NP) was added to the Heart Rhythm team to create a program to improve AF care after an ED visit. Telephone practice was one of the many processes created. OUTCOMES: Findings revealed that 37 of 90 patients presented to the ED with AF prior to telephone contact and 7 of 90 patients did so post-telephone contact (P < .001). CONCLUSION: Telephone practice led by an NP provides an opportunity to improve assessment and management of patient with AF and offers a promising cost-effective method to reduce ED visits in the AF patient population.

ABSTRACT

Atrial fibrillation (AF) is a risk factor for ischemic stroke and reported to be associated with severe obstructive sleep apnea (OSA). The aim of this study was to determine the occurrence of newly detected AF in patients with severe OSA and no previous history of AF. Prospective observational study included patients with severe OSA (Apnea-Hypopnea Index [AHI] ≥ 30) and no history of AF. Primary outcome was detection of AF lasting ≥10 seconds. Patients were subjected to 2 24-hour Holter monitors, and if no AF was detected, implanted with a Medtronic Reveal XT implantable loop recorder. Follow-up was done every 6 months for a total of 3years. Implantable loop recorder was explanted if the primary outcome was detected (AF) or the battery was exhausted. Of the 31 patients enrolled, 6 withdrew participation in the study before implantation. Mean age was 57 ± 10years, mean body mass index was 35 ± 6; 52% male patients. Hypertension 56% and coronary artery disease 24%. Mean AHI was 55 ± 18. AF was detected in 5 patients (20%). AF mean duration was 4.8hours (range 20 seconds to 15.3 hours). Mean time to diagnosis was 11 ± 7 months. Male gender was predictive for AF detection (p = 0.04). Continuous positive airway pressure therapy was used by 96% of patients with 68% total adherence. Mean follow-up was 27 months. In conclusion, extended cardiac monitoring of patients with severe OSA may facilitate the identification of newly detected AF.
